screen_pos_t
int count, screen_pos_t row, screen_pos_t col);
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row);
static void tem_virtual_cls(struct tem_vt_state *, size_t, screen_pos_t,
screen_pos_t);
size_t, screen_pos_t, screen_pos_t);
int count, screen_pos_t row, screen_pos_t col);
int, screen_pos_t, screen_pos_t);
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t);
screen_pos_t, screen_pos_t);
screen_pos_t, screen_pos_t, scre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t);
static void tem_pix_cls_range(struct tem_vt_state *, screen_pos_t, int,
int, screen_pos_t, int, int, bool);
screen_pos_t, screen_pos_t);
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row)
tem_clear_chars(struct tem_vt_state *tem, int count, screen_pos_t row,
screen_pos_t col)
int count, screen_pos_t row, screen_pos_t col)
tem_image_display(struct tem_vt_state *tem, screen_pos_t s_row,
screen_pos_t s_col, screen_pos_t e_row, screen_pos_t e_col)
screen_pos_t i, j;
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row)
int count, screen_pos_t row, screen_pos_t col)
screen_pos_t row, screen_pos_t col)
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row)
screen_pos_t row, screen_pos_t col)
screen_pos_t tabstop;
screen_pos_t tabstop;
tem->tvs_c_cursor.row = (screen_pos_t)row;
tem->tvs_c_cursor.col = (screen_pos_t)col;
tem->tvs_tabs[tem->tvs_ntabs++] = (screen_pos_t)j;
screen_pos_t row, int nrows, int offset_y,
screen_pos_t col, int ncols, int offset_x,
size_t count, screen_pos_t row, screen_pos_t col)
screen_pos_t row, screen_pos_t col)
(screen_pos_t)row;
plat_tem_display_prom_cursor(screen_pos_t row, screen_pos_t col)
screen_pos_t x, y;
vidc_text_set_cursor(screen_pos_t row, screen_pos_t col, bool visible)
vidc_text_get_cursor(screen_pos_t *row, screen_pos_t *col)
static void vidc_text_set_cursor(screen_pos_t, screen_pos_t, bool);
static void vidc_text_get_cursor(screen_pos_t *, screen_pos_t *);
screen_pos_t x;
screen_pos_t y;
screen_pos_t col;
screen_pos_t row;
screen_pos_t *tvs_tabs; /* tab stops */
screen_pos_t, screen_pos_t);
screen_pos_t, screen_pos_t, scre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t);
void (*tsc_cls)(struct tem_vt_state *, int, screen_pos_t, screen_pos_t);
void tem_image_display(struct tem_vt_state *, scre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t);
(screen_pos_t)row;
int count, screen_pos_t row, screen_pos_t col,
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row,
int, int, screen_pos_t, screen_pos_t,
static void tem_safe_virtual_cls(struct tem_vt_state *, int, screen_pos_t,
screen_pos_t);
term_char_t *, int, screen_pos_t, screen_pos_t);
static void tem_safe_virtual_copy(struct tem_vt_state *, screen_pos_t,
screen_pos_t, screen_pos_t, screen_pos_t,
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row,
screen_pos_t, screen_pos_t);
tem_safe_clear_chars(struct tem_vt_state *tem, int count, screen_pos_t row,
screen_pos_t col, cred_t *credp, enum called_from called_from)
int count, screen_pos_t row, screen_pos_t col,
int height, int width, screen_pos_t row, screen_pos_t col,
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row,
int count, screen_pos_t row, screen_pos_t col, cred_t *credp,
screen_pos_t row, screen_pos_t col,
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row,
screen_pos_t row, screen_pos_t col, cred_t *credp,
screen_pos_t tabstop;
screen_pos_t tabstop;
tem->tvs_c_cursor.row = (screen_pos_t)row;
tem->tvs_c_cursor.col = (screen_pos_t)col;
tem->tvs_tabs[tem->tvs_ntabs++] = (screen_pos_t)j;
screen_pos_t row, int nrows, int offset_y,
screen_pos_t col, int ncols, int offset_x,
int count, screen_pos_t row, screen_pos_t col)
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row)
screen_pos_t s_col, screen_pos_t s_row,
screen_pos_t e_col, screen_pos_t e_row,
screen_pos_t t_col, screen_pos_t t_row)
int count, screen_pos_t row, screen_pos_t col)
screen_pos_t x;
screen_pos_t y;
screen_pos_t col;
screen_pos_t row;
screen_pos_t *tvs_tabs; /* tab stops */
screen_pos_t, screen_pos_t, cred_t *, enum called_from);
screen_pos_t, screen_pos_t, scre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t, cred_t *, enum called_from);
screen_pos_t, screen_pos_t, cred_t *, enum called_from);
int, screen_pos_t, screen_pos_t, cred_t *, enum called_from);
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t,
int count, screen_pos_t row, screen_pos_t col,
int, screen_pos_t, screen_pos_t, cred_t *, enum called_from);
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t,
screen_pos_t, screen_pos_t,
void tem_safe_pix_cls(struct tem_vt_state *, int, screen_pos_t, screen_pos_t,
screen_pos_t, int, int,
screen_pos_t, int, int,
screen_pos_t row; /* Row to display data at */
screen_pos_t col; /* Col to display data at */
screen_pos_t s_row; /* Starting row */
screen_pos_t s_col; /* Starting col */
screen_pos_t e_row; /* Ending row */
screen_pos_t e_col; /* Ending col */
screen_pos_t t_row; /* Row to move to */
screen_pos_t t_col; /* Col to move to */
screen_pos_t row; /* Row to display cursor at */
screen_pos_t col; /* Col to display cursor at */
screen_pos_t *row, screen_pos_t *col);
screen_pos_t *row, screen_pos_t *col)